GB-Witham: ECFRS00380 Multi-Agency Incident Transfer Adoption (MAIT)

Published

Supplier(s)

AVR Group Limited

Value

44,100 GBP

Description

IT software package. Purchase agreement for the Multi-Agency Incident Transfer software. Contract award notice for the license of a Software License solution awarded via a direct award on the National Fire Chiefs Council C22056 Multi Agency Incident Transfer (MAIT) framework. The contract is for a period of 2 years with an option to extend for a further 2 x one year extensions.
